The Friends of Southfield Public Arts and the Southfield Public Art Commission have commissioned world-renowned Mexican sculptor Sebastian to create a “signature piece” in Southfield for the Nine Mile Corridor Connectivity, Recreation, and Placemaking Project that extends from I-75 in Hazel Park to I-275 in Farmington Hills. Sebastian’s masterwork will stand 98 feet tall at the intersection of Nine Mile Road and Southfield Freeway. About the Friends of the Southfield Public Arts
The Friends of Southfield Public Arts is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ization dedicated to furthering public art projects throughout Southfield. Its mission is to finance the procurement, transportation, installation, and restoration of art for public enjoyment.
